Cast Iron Brie Fondue

Brie has a mellow and somewhat nutty flavor, which is best accented by serving with sweet ingredients.

Preheat the oven to 400 F. Place the brie cheese into the center of the cast iron skillet. Pour on the maple syrup until it reaches the edges - try not to overflow the top of the brie or else the maple syrup will start to burn if too much is in the skillet too early. Sprinkle on the thyme.
Bake for fifteen to twenty minutes, or until the center of the brie is wobbly and just slightly puffed.
Remove from the oven and cut a slit from the center through to the edge. Serve with croustinis and fresh fruit and vegetables. Enjoy!
